Filing period opens for various candidates

The filing period opens Monday for would-be candidates in East Bay nonpartisan city, school board, special district and other regional races in the upcoming general election.

Numerous city councils, special districts and school and college boards in Contra Costa and Alameda counties will hold elections in conjunction with the presidential and statewide general election on Nov. 4.

Large regional agencies with elections include BART, AC-Transit, East Bay Municipal Utility District and the East Bay Regional Park District.

In Alameda County, the cities of Alameda, Albany, Berkeley, Dublin, Fremont Pleasanton, Oakland, San Leandro and Union City will select city council members.

Nearly every city, school board and special district in Contra Costa County will hold elections.

The filing period closes Aug. 8.

In Contra Costa County, forms to file for seats on school and special district boards and the city of Martinez are available at the Contra Costa County Elections Office, 555 Escobar Street in Martinez.

Forms for all other city offices are available at the appropriate city clerk's office.

For more information, call 925-335-7800.

In Alameda County, obtain forms at the Alameda County Registrar of Voters Office at 1225 Fallon Street G-1 in Oakland or at the appropriate city clerk's office. For more information, call 510 267-8683.
